Sickle cell anemia is a disease that causes the blood cells to be shaped like sickles instead of being circular. The table describes the phenotype of red blood cells when a particular genotype is present.
Genotype Effect
homozygous recessive sickle cells
homozygous dominant normal, circular blood cells
heterozygous some normal cells and some sickle cells in the blood
What type of inheritance is shown by the genes that control sickle cell anemia? Explain your response.
